How Does China Zhongwang Navigate the Aluminum Extrusion Arena?
China Zhongwang, a major player in the global aluminum processing sector, is at the forefront of manufacturing high-quality aluminum extrusion products. Its focus on sectors like transportation and renewable energy highlights its significance in today's industrial landscape. As of early 2025, the company is adapting to the increasing demand for lightweight materials, particularly within the electric vehicle market.
Founded in 1993, China Zhongwang has rapidly grown to become the largest industrial aluminum extrusion product developer and manufacturer in Asia. Where Does China Zhongwang’ Stand in the Current Market?
China Zhongwang holds a significant market position within the industrial aluminum extrusion sector. It is recognized as the largest in Asia and the second largest globally, demonstrating a strong competitive presence. The company primarily serves key sectors such as transportation, machinery, equipment, and electric power engineering, offering a diverse range of fabricated industrial aluminum extrusion products. This includes high-precision aluminum plates, sheets, and deep-processing products, catering to various high-end applications.
The company's core operations focus on manufacturing and supplying a wide array of aluminum products. Its value proposition lies in providing high-quality, customized aluminum solutions that meet the specific needs of its clients. This includes specialized products designed for lightweighting in vehicles and high-strength materials for aerospace and marine applications. The company's commitment to innovation and deep-processing capabilities further enhances its value proposition.
Geographically, China remains its largest market, though China Zhongwang is expanding its international footprint. This expansion is particularly noticeable in regions with high demand for advanced aluminum solutions. The company's strategic shift from a general aluminum profile manufacturer to a high-end industrial aluminum solutions provider has been a key factor in its market positioning.
While specific 2024-2025 market share figures are not readily available, China Zhongwang's extensive production capacity and integrated value chain indicate substantial scale. The company's position is particularly strong in the Chinese domestic market. This strength is supported by national policies promoting domestic manufacturing and infrastructure development. The company's financial health reflects its large-scale operations, though it faces challenges related to global economic shifts and raw material price volatility.
China Zhongwang offers a diverse product portfolio, including industrial aluminum extrusions, high-precision aluminum plates, and deep-processing products. These products serve sectors like transportation, machinery, and electric power engineering. The emphasis on high-end applications and customized solutions highlights the company's focus on value-added products. This strategic approach allows the company to meet the specific needs of its diverse clientele.
China Zhongwang's primary market is China, where it benefits from robust domestic demand and supportive policies. The company is also increasing its presence in international markets, focusing on regions that require advanced aluminum solutions. Who Are the Main Competitors Challenging China Zhongwang?
The competitive landscape for China Zhongwang, a major player in the aluminum extrusion market, involves a diverse array of competitors. This landscape includes both domestic and international firms vying for market share. Understanding these competitors is crucial for assessing China Zhongwang's position and strategic challenges.
The aluminum extrusion market is dynamic, with competition driven by factors such as pricing, product innovation, and the ability to meet stringent quality standards. Emerging trends like sustainable production and additive manufacturing are also influencing the competitive dynamics. China Zhongwang's primary competitors include both domestic and international players. Domestically, firms like Aluminium Corporation of China Limited (CHALCO) present significant competition due to their scale and diversified operations. Internationally, companies like Constellium, Hydro Extruded Solutions, and Kaiser Aluminum challenge China Zhongwang with advanced technology and global reach.
Within China, Aluminium Corporation of China Limited (CHALCO) is a major competitor. CHALCO's state-owned status and integrated operations give it a competitive edge. Smaller, specialized aluminum processors also compete in specific segments or regions.
Globally, China Zhongwang faces competition from companies such as Constellium, Hydro Extruded Solutions (part of Norsk Hydro), and Kaiser Aluminum. These firms compete on technological advancements and market reach. These international players often have strong brand recognition.
Competition often revolves around pricing, product innovation, and quality. The ability to meet industry-specific certifications is also crucial. Emerging players and industry consolidation further shape the competitive environment.
Market share shifts are often proprietary information, but competitive dynamics are clear. Factors like new alloys and complex profiles drive competition. The automotive and aerospace industries have strict quality requirements.

What Gives China Zhongwang a Competitive Edge Over Its Rivals?
Understanding the competitive landscape of China Zhongwang involves examining its core strengths. The company, a major player in the aluminum extrusion sector, has cultivated several key advantages that distinguish it from its competitors. These advantages contribute to its market position and ability to compete effectively in the industry. China Zhongwang's competitive edge is significantly shaped by its integrated production capabilities. This includes everything from research and development to the final extrusion process. This vertical integration provides the company with control over quality, cost efficiency, and the ability to innovate quickly. This comprehensive approach allows them to meet the specific needs of various high-value sectors, like transportation and engineering.
Another critical advantage is its focus on research and development. This commitment allows China Zhongwang to offer unique products and technologies. The company holds numerous patents related to aluminum alloy compositions and extrusion processes, which contribute to its technological leadership in specific niches. This focus on innovation allows them to stay ahead in a competitive market.
China Zhongwang has a substantial production capacity, including advanced extrusion presses. This allows for the production of large-section industrial aluminum extrusion products. This scale is crucial for meeting the demands of high-end applications in transportation and engineering.
The company invests heavily in research and development, particularly in advanced aluminum alloys and complex extrusion profiles. This focus enables the development of proprietary technologies and specialized products. The company holds numerous patents, contributing to its technological leadership.
China Zhongwang benefits from significant economies of scale due to its large production volume. This scale helps reduce per-unit production costs, providing a competitive pricing advantage. This advantage is particularly beneficial for large-volume orders, allowing the company to compete effectively in the market.
The company has a well-established distribution network within China and a growing international presence. This network ensures efficient delivery and customer service. Long-standing relationships with major clients further solidify its market position, fostering customer loyalty and repeat business.
China Zhongwang's competitive advantages are rooted in its integrated production, R&D focus, economies of scale, and distribution network. What Industry Trends Are Reshaping China Zhongwang’s Competitive Landscape?
The industrial aluminum extrusion sector is experiencing significant shifts, impacting companies like China Zhongwang. These changes stem from evolving market demands and technological advancements. Understanding these trends is crucial for assessing China Zhongwang's competitive position and future prospects.
The competitive landscape for China Zhongwang is dynamic, shaped by industry trends, challenges, and opportunities. Factors such as increasing demand for lightweight materials, sustainable manufacturing practices, and technological advancements are reshaping the industry. Furthermore, geopolitical and economic factors play a role in defining China Zhongwang's strategic direction and market performance.
The aluminum extrusion industry is seeing a rise in demand for lightweight materials, especially from the automotive sector, with a focus on electric vehicles (EVs). Sustainable manufacturing practices are also gaining importance. Technological advancements are driving operational improvements.
Intensified competition from both domestic and international players poses a challenge. Overcapacity in certain segments of the aluminum industry may occur. Fluctuations in raw material prices and geopolitical tensions could also impact the company.
There are opportunities to expand into emerging markets with developing infrastructure. Diversifying the product portfolio to cater to new applications is also an option. Strategic partnerships can help leverage strengths and access new markets.
China Zhongwang is likely to emphasize high-value, specialized products and sustainable manufacturing. A strong focus on research and development (R&D) and global market penetration will be crucial for future success. The company can leverage its expertise in aluminum extrusion.
The global EV market is projected to grow by 15-20% annually through 2030, presenting a significant opportunity for China Zhongwang. This growth drives demand for lightweight aluminum components. Regulatory changes and trade policies will influence production costs and market access.
- Increased Demand: Growing demand for lightweight materials, especially in the EV and aerospace sectors.
- Sustainability: Emphasis on reducing carbon footprints and promoting recycling.
- Technological Advancements: Development of new alloys and the integration of Industry 4.0 technologies.
